VR in the Gaming Industry

Virtual Reality (VR) has revolutionized the gaming industry, providing players with an immersive and lifelike experience like never before. With VR headsets and motion tracking technology, gamers can now step into a virtual world and interact with it in ways that were previously unimaginable.

In VR games, players are no longer limited to pressing buttons on a controller; they can physically move their bodies to navigate through virtual environments. This level of interactivity not only enhances gameplay but also creates a sense of presence and realism that traditional gaming cannot match.

Moreover, VR allows for more realistic graphics and visuals, making the game worlds feel incredibly lifelike. Players can explore detailed landscapes, encounter believable characters, and experience breathtaking moments that transport them to another reality altogether.

But it’s not just about the visual aspect – sound plays a crucial role in creating an immersive gaming experience too. With VR technology, developers can incorporate 3D audio effects that accurately simulate sounds coming from different directions. This adds another layer of depth to the gameplay by enhancing situational awareness and creating a truly captivating auditory experience.

Additionally, multiplayer VR games have gained popularity as they offer social interactions within virtual worlds. Players can join forces or compete against each other while feeling as if they are right next to their friends or opponents – even if they are physically miles apart.

The versatility of VR in gaming is further amplified by its compatibility with various genres. Whether you enjoy action-packed shooters or mind-bending puzzles, there’s something for everyone in the realm of virtual reality experiences.

VR in Education and Training

Virtual Reality (VR) technology is not limited to just the gaming industry; it also has immense potential in revolutionizing education and training. By creating immersive virtual environments, VR allows students and trainees to engage actively with the subject matter, enhancing their learning experience.

In traditional classrooms, concepts can sometimes be difficult to grasp or visualize. However, with VR, complex topics can be brought to life through interactive simulations and visualizations. For example, students studying astronomy can explore distant galaxies or witness historical events firsthand. This hands-on approach enables learners to deepen their understanding by experiencing rather than memorizing information from textbooks.

Furthermore, VR provides a safe space for practical training in fields such as medicine or engineering. Trainee surgeons can practice delicate procedures repeatedly without any risk to real patients while engineers can simulate scenarios involving hazardous environments or extreme conditions.

Another advantage of using VR in education is its ability to cater to different learning styles. Visual learners benefit from the immersive visuals and 3D models while auditory learners can access audio-based explanations within the virtual environment.

Despite its many benefits, integrating VR into educational institutions may face some challenges such as cost limitations and technical requirements. However, as technology advances and becomes more accessible, these barriers are gradually being overcome.

Benefits of VR for Learning

Virtual Reality (VR) has the potential to revolutionize the way we learn. By immersing students in realistic and interactive environments, VR can enhance their understanding and retention of complex concepts. Here are some key benefits of using VR in education:

Improved Engagement: Traditional classroom settings can sometimes struggle to capture students’ attention. However, with VR, learning becomes a dynamic and immersive experience that actively engages learners. Students are more likely to be motivated and excited about their studies when they have the opportunity to explore virtual worlds.

Enhanced Retention: Studies have shown that experiential learning leads to better retention rates compared to traditional methods. With VR, students can interact with virtual objects or scenarios, reinforcing what they’ve learned through hands-on experiences. This active involvement enhances memory consolidation and improves long-term recall.

Real-world Simulations: One of the most powerful aspects of VR is its ability to recreate real-world scenarios without any physical risks or limitations. For example, medical students can practice surgical procedures in a simulated operating room before ever stepping foot into an actual OR. This allows learners to gain valuable practical skills in a safe environment.

Personalized Learning: Every student learns at their own pace and has unique learning preferences. VR technology enables personalized learning experiences by adapting content based on individual needs and progress. Learners can revisit challenging topics or explore advanced concepts at their own speed, fostering a deeper understanding.

Collaborative Learning Opportunities: In addition to individualized experiences, VR also facilitates collaborative learning opportunities by connecting students from different locations virtually. Through shared virtual spaces, learners can engage in group projects or simulations where they collaboratively solve problems or discuss ideas.

Accessibility for All Learners: Virtual reality eliminates many physical barriers found in traditional classrooms, making education more accessible for all learners regardless of disabilities or geographical location. It provides equal opportunities for individuals who may face challenges due to mobility issues or limited resources.

Future of VR in Education

As technology continues to advance at a rapid pace, the potential for virtual reality (VR) in education is becoming more apparent. The future of VR in education holds great promise for revolutionizing the way students learn and engage with educational content.

One area where VR has already shown immense potential is in anatomy and biology lessons. With VR headsets and immersive experiences, students can explore the human body like never before. They can dissect virtual organs, navigate through intricate systems, and gain a deeper understanding of complex biological processes.

In addition to science subjects, VR also has applications in history and geography lessons. Imagine being able to transport students back in time to experience historical events firsthand or take them on virtual field trips around the world without leaving the classroom. This level of immersion can greatly enhance student engagement and make learning more memorable.

Furthermore, VR has tremendous potential for hands-on training simulations. Whether it’s practicing surgical procedures or honing engineering skills, students can benefit from realistic scenarios that allow them to apply knowledge in a safe environment.

The possibilities are endless when it comes to using VR as an educational tool. As technology advances further, we can expect even more interactive and engaging experiences tailored specifically for different subjects and age groups.
